Stumbled upon a Sea of Orange: Witnessing the Beauty of Guilin's Sunset

Friends, I'd say Guilin's sunset is the ultimate visual feast! I recently witnessed a sunset in Guilin, and the breathtaking scenery is forever etched in my memory. Now, I'm sharing this super detailed guide with you all. If you're planning a trip to Guilin, save this now! Experience 1. Choosing the Viewing Spot: I recommend two perfect spots. One is Xiangong Mountain. From the summit, you can overlook the first bend of the Lijiang River. At sunset, the afterglow paints the river surface, turning the landscape into a mesmerizing orange-red watercolor painting. The other spot is Laozhai Mountain. It's less crowded, allowing for a more tranquil sunset experience. Enjoy a 360-degree panoramic view of the sunset, with distant mountains and villages bathed in the golden light, creating a truly magical atmosphere. 2. Timing: Check the sunset time on a weather app beforehand, and arrive at your chosen spot 1–2 hours early. The road to Xiangong Mountain, for example, is a bit rugged, so allow ample time for the climb and to secure a good viewing spot. I arrived at Xiangong Mountain 1.5 hours early, which gave me plenty of time to reach the top and snag a front-row spot at the viewing platform, ensuring a perfect view of the entire sunset. 3. Waiting for the Sunset: Once you've arrived, find a comfortable spot to sit and patiently await the sunset. Take in the surrounding scenery and feel the gentle breeze. As the sun begins its descent, the sky transforms into a vibrant spectacle of colors, shifting from azure to orange-yellow, and finally to deep purple. The entire process is incredibly awe-inspiring. Don't rush off after the sun dips below the horizon. The sky takes on a dreamy blue hue, perfect for capturing stunning photos. In that moment, all my worries vanished, replaced by the awe-inspiring scenery, leaving me with a sense of wonder and gratitude. What to Bring 1. Sun Protection: Sunglasses🕶️, a hat, and sunscreen are essential. The sun in Guilin is strong, even in the late afternoon, so protect your skin. 2. Camera Gear: A camera or a phone with a good camera is a must. Sunset moments are fleeting, so a good camera will help you capture these precious memories. Don't forget a power bank to avoid running out of battery. 3. Comfortable Shoes: If you're heading to Xiangong Mountain or Laozhai Mountain, you'll need to hike, so comfortable athletic or hiking shoes are essential for a comfortable climb. 4. Jacket: The temperature can drop in the evening on the mountains, so bring a light jacket to stay warm. 5. Water and Snacks: You might get thirsty or hungry while waiting for the sunset, so pack some water and snacks to keep your energy levels up. Important Notes 1. Safety: Be cautious on the way to the viewing spots, especially on mountain roads. Slow down your driving speed or pace. When enjoying the view from the mountain, stay within safe areas and avoid taking risks for photos. 2. Environmental Protection: While admiring the scenery, please respect the environment and refrain from littering. Take your trash with you when you leave to keep the area clean. 3. Respect Local Customs: Guilin is a region with diverse ethnic groups. Respect local customs and traditions to avoid unnecessary misunderstandings due to cultural differences.
